Abstract
Porphycene photosensitizers bearing two or four methoxyethyl side chains were synthesized in nine steps from commercially available starting materials. Ether cleavage led to (hydroxyethyl)-and (bromoethy1) porphycenes that were converted to vinyl and benzo derivatives.
